Sevilla are considering an approach for out-of-favour Chelsea midfielder Tiemoue Bakayoko, according to reports.
ABC de Sevilla say Los Rojiblancos are interested in the 23-year-old, who started 34 matches in central midfield for the Blues last season.
The Paris-born midfielder moved to Stamford Bridge last summer from Monaco in a reported €40m deal, and it appears the Andalusian club have identified him as a potential replacement for Steven N’Zonzi.
There is no indication that a bid has been lodged by Sevilla but it is thought the FA Cup holders would be willing to sanction an exit this summer at the right price.
